WebThe length of any chord can be calculated using the following formula: Chord Length = 2 × √ (r 2 − d 2) Is Diameter a Chord of a Circle? Yes, the diameter is also considered as a chord of the circle. The diameter is the longest chord possible in a circle and it divides the circle into two equal parts. Quiz on Chord of a Circle

(This is an important number, because as we will see later, it governs the skin ... ghassan faroun hospitalWebExample 2: In the given circle, O is the center with a radius of 5 inches. Find the length of the chord AB if the length of the perpendicular drawn from the center is 4 inches. Solution: AB is the chord of circle. Since OM is perpendicular to AB, AOM will be a right-angled triangle.
